As the sun went down, it was finally Christmas Eve. Jack and Susan sipped
hot cocoa mommy made inside of Stanley’s wonderful snowman house. “You are
the best Christmas present ever Stanley.” Susan said and she hugged his
neck getting snow on her cheeks.
“But there are so many wonderful presents to have Susan. What would be the
best present in the whole world?” Stanley asked.
“I don’t know Stanley” Jack said feeling confused a little.
“Well let’s go see.” The magical snowman said. Just like that, they were
flying through the night sky just like Santa but holding onto Stanley snow
hands for all they could. They stopped at a big palace of a mighty king.
“These children have a castle and they are princes and princesses. Maybe I
should make you the kings kids for a Christmas present.” He said loudly so
the guards nearby got nervous.
“No, “Susan said shyly. I wouldn’t be able to run and play with everyone,
just other princesses, I wouldn’t like that. Show us more.”
And Stanley did. They flew like the wind passing birds and airplanes and
knocking on the windows to spell out Merry Christmas in the frost as they
flew next to them going wherever Stanley wanted to go. They saw children
who go wonderful stables full of horses, others that got staring roles in
the best movies just because their parents were powerful and rich. They
even met children who wished to become an eagle and fly high in the sky or
any animal they wanted and the magic of Christmas made it all so. Stanley
said because of the powerful magic of Christmas, all of these things could
be theirs. Jack and Susan loved the wonderful travel and seeing so many
amazing and exotic things but finally Susan said. “Stanley can we go
home?”
Back at their back yard, Stanley served them cookies in his little home
again. “But why don’t you want the most expensive presents and ponies and
all these things. After all, Christmas brings that kind of magic.” He
asked.
“Well,” Jack said. “The more we flew, the more I knew it wouldn’t be
Christmas unless it was with our mommy and our daddy in our little house
with regular presents. Somehow, those presents don’t mean Christmas to me.
“Me too, Stanley. Something was missing from all that and that thing,
whatever it is, makes Christmas wonderful.”
“Then I know the most special present of all that will make Christmas more
special than ever before.” Stanley said with a big snowman smile and he
clapped his hands. Instantly Jack and Susan were in a stable. They saw
Mary and Joseph looking down. And then Joseph signaled that it was their
turn to look.
“Jack,” Susan said gasping with awe and wonder at where they were. “It’s
the baby Jesus.” And they stepped up and looked down at his innocent eyes
and his sweet smile. Jack even reached down and stroked his cheek. For his
whole life, Jack never forgot how the skin of the newborn savior felt.
Outside of the stable, they ran to Stanley.
“This is the present that is better than any we have seen tonight.” Jack
said happily.
“That’s because God gave this present to give us life that can never end.”
Stanley explained. “Horses would go away, mansions would decay, toys would
break or you would grow out of all those things. But life eternal is
something you will never stop using.”
“It feels like it really is Christmas now Stanley!” Susan said loudly and
with that, they were instantly on their porch.
“You know it all along that nothing could compare with Jesus for the best
Christmas present ever didn’t you?” Jack said to Stanley.
“Yes Jack and I knew you knew it too. It was fun having an adventure but
now its time to worship the new born king.”
“But we don’t want you to go Stanley.” Susan said with a small sob.
“I won’t be far away. Next Christmas build a snowman twice as good and we
will have adventures a hundred times better than these. But just like this
Christmas Eve, we will end each night worshiping Jesus for saving all
people from their sins.”
“HOORAY!” the kids shouted and they gave final snowy kisses and hugs to
their wonderful friend and ran inside to get on their best Christmas
outfit’s to go to church and truly praise Jesus for coming to fill their
lives with love and the joy of Christmas every year.
